摘要: 为了提高卫星固定业务上行频段的频谱利用效率,提出了一种无授权接入该频段的方案。利用卫星的“空闲”信道构建认知无线电业务信道,同时采用宽带扩频信号,构建具有较低功率谱密度和较强抗干扰能力的公共协调信道。给出了Ad Hoc和星型两种基本的无授权接入模型,重点分析了认知无线电对卫星可能造成的干扰。理论分析和仿真结果表明,众多感知用户可以利用该方案,以低于1%的干扰概率避免对卫星接收机造成有害干扰,实现在卫星固定业务上行频段的无授权接入。

Abstract:

In order to improve the spectrum usage of the up-band of fixed satellite service (FSS), an unlicensed access scheme is presented. The satellite’s idle channel is used for cognitive radio service channel, and a common coordinate channel with lower transmitting power and better anti-jamming ability is proposed. The two basic unlicensed access modes, Ad hoc and star mode, are considered. According to interference temperature, the interference of the cognitive radios to satellite receiver is analyzed. Analysis and simulation results show that, by using this scheme to avoid interference to satellite receiver with the jam-probability lower than 1%, many cognitive radios can access the band without special authorization.
